The Norman milites spent quite a bit of his time fighting on foot. Henry I made good use of dismounted troops at the Battle of Tinchebrai in 1106. He was besieging the castle when his brother Robert arrived with an opposing relief force. Henry dismounted a large number of his milites and used them to support the lighter pedites infantry to good effect!

Time and again we read of heavily outnumbered Normans smashing a superior enemy force. While this may very well be propaganda, we must concede that not all who wrote of these exploits were pro-Norman. We must also remember that unlike most of its opponents, Norman cavalry could, and often did, dismount to fight as infantry when the situation required. This tactical flexibility was surely a strong weapon in the Norman arsenal!
